Web22 Feb 2024 · Water. Snake plants are very drought-tolerant, so it is important to not overwater them. During the growing season, which is typically from spring to fall, water your snake plant every two to three weeks. During the winter months, reduce watering to once a month. Allow the top inch of soil to dry out between waterings. Web7 Dec 2024 · This is a short growing species of snake plant, only growing about 4-6″ tall. Web24 Oct 2024 · Snake plants are relatively slow-growing plants. They are not heavy feeders, being well adapted to life in poor soils. They will respond to an application of fertilizer, however. Fertilizer application once every 3 months will help keep the leaves vibrant and promote new growth. It is not necessary to fertilize these plants during the winter ... Web11 Apr 2024 · Instead, carefully stick your finger or a wooden chopstick a couple of inches into the soil. If you feel any moisture or see soil stick to the chopstick, hold off on watering. Water from the bottom of the pot, if possible. This encourages the roots to grow downward and deep, helping to stabilize the thick, tall leaves.
